Summary

Taxation of civil service annuities. Provides that the maximum state income tax deduction for federal civil service annuity income is equal to the lesser of: (1) the amount of federal civil service annuity income received during the taxable year; or (2) the average annual federal Social Security retirement benefit paid to Indiana retired workers during the calendar year preceding the taxpayer's taxable year. Retains the provision that reduces the deduction by the amount of any federal Social Security and railroad retirement benefits received by the taxpayer during the taxable year.
